Workshops
Engage 11
Engage educators as they learn 11 research-based engagement strategies designed for Tier One general education classrooms where teachers differentiate and accommodate lessons to support every student. Learn to assist English Language Learners with academic conversations and support students with special needs with activities designed to encourage socialization, emotional support, and academic success.
Strategies for Co-Teaching
This presentation will provide the participants with 11 co-teaching strategies. Teams will learn best practices for implementing co-teaching and view videos of co-teaching in practice.
Engage Early Learners
A toolbox of strategies to engage all early childhood learners, provides participants with research-based engagement strategies for instructional support. Learn to facilitate peer interaction in small and large group activities.
Inclusive Practices for All
Learn 11 steps for establishing an inclusive school or center. Full integration of every student means understanding how to individualize and group within teaching environments. Students with and without disabilities learn side-by-side when proper planning, preparation, and participation take place.
Bio
Dr. Belinda Karge is a Professor of Doctoral Studies at Concordia University Irvine and Professor Emeritus from California State University, Fullerton. Over her career, she has made numerous presentations to groups of school district employees, keynoted conferences, and provided professional development to overseas educators. She is an expert in research-based instructional strategies and has authored five curriculum texts, four book chapters, 125+ articles and numerous grants (totaling $20+ million dollars).
